Have trouble wrapping, and want to make your gifts pretty? Instead of using traditional bows (that either go directly in the trash or reused on your gift next year), try using dried flowers as an embellishment. Your recipient will have a nicer smelling, au natural decoration!

When giving presents for the upcoming holidays (or birthdays), reuse newspaper or old wallpaper instead of purchasing wrapping paper. The recipient can laugh at last week’s “Funnie’s” section (or catch up on the news) while opening their gift.
